The present invention provides a stimulus presentation system which determines a mental state and changes presentation contents of a problem based on the determined mental state. The system determines the mental state by measuring gaze and cerebral function of a user, and changes presentation contents of a problem based on the determined mental state.

Disclosed is a device using a biological optical measurement technology to evaluate mood states in daily life of an examinee by presenting a first task once or a plurality of times and then presents a second task a plurality of times, calculating a hemoglobin signal of a predetermined measurement point for the first task and a hemoglobin signal of a predetermined measurement point for the second task, and calculating quantitative values using the obtained hemoglobin signals.

An information display terminal allows a user to grasp rapidly and surely the direction to a destination, and can guide the user to the destination without placing a burden on the user. The information display terminal is provided at a passage, and its display screen displays a route guidance screen that guides a route to the destination. The route guidance screen displays a pseudo-action image that shows the walking motion, and a destination display information image indicating a destination name such as “Subway Ticket Gate”. The action image shows the motion of walking toward the destination, but the display position does not change. The destination display information image is displayed in front of the action image in the advancing direction.

In one embodiment, a circuit includes an input buffer, an output buffer, a counter, an issuing unit, a first controller, a register, and a second controller. The input buffer and the output buffer have a variable storage capacity. The counter cyclically counts from a first value to a second value. The issuing unit issues a write command if a count value of the counter is a third value and issues a read command if the count value is a fourth value. The register stores a first setting value, a second setting value and a third setting value to be capable of changing each of the setting values. The second controller controls the components to set the storage capacity, the second value, and one of the third and fourth values respectively to values corresponding to the first to third setting values.

A method for manufacturing a honeycomb structural body having a honeycomb unit includes obtaining a honeycomb molded body including a compound containing a phosphate group zeolite and an inorganic binder. The honeycomb molded body has a plurality of through holes that are defined by cell walls and arranged in a longitudinal direction of the honeycomb molded body. The honeycomb molded body is dried. The dried honeycomb molded body is fired to obtain the honeycomb unit. At least one of the honeycomb unit and the dried honeycomb molded body is stored so that a difference in moisture content is approximately 5 mass % or less between a moisture content of the cell walls at a center part of a cross section perpendicular to the longitudinal direction and a moisture content of the cell walls at an outer periphery part of the cross section perpendicular to the longitudinal direction.
